City Council Meeting 09-22-25

City Council

Meeting Timeline

Each bar represents a transcript segment coloured by topic. Hover to see speaker and timestamp details.

0:0053:581:47:56
budget
community services
economic development
education
environment
housing
procedural
public safety
public works
recognition
transportation
Speakers
City Council9/9 selected
Other2/2 selected

Total Speaking Time by Speaker

Aggregate across all meetings, ranked.

Total Speaking Time by Topic

Combined time all selected speakers spent on each topic, ranked.

Speaker Comparison by Topic

Each group is a topic. Bars compare speakers side by side.

Guerline Alcy Jabouin
Holly Garcia
John Hanlon
Katy Rogers
Michael Marchese
Peter Pietrantonio
Robert Van Campen
Stephanie Martins
Stephanie Smith
Town Clerk
Wayne Matewsky

Topic Share by Speaker

Each donut: one topic. Slices show each speaker's share of that topic's time.

Guerline Alcy Jabouin
Holly Garcia
John Hanlon
Katy Rogers
Michael Marchese
Peter Pietrantonio
Robert Van Campen
Stephanie Martins
Stephanie Smith
Town Clerk
Wayne Matewsky
Budget & Taxes1m 39s
Economic Development2m 6s
Education21s
Environment3m 1s
Housing1m 5s
Infrastructure6m 13s
Public Safety1m 1s
Social Services6m 56s
Transportation1m 57s

Time Allocation by Speaker

Each donut: one speaker. Slices show what share of their time went to each topic.

Budget & Taxes
Economic Development
Education
Environment
Housing
Infrastructure
Public Safety
Social Services
Transportation
Guerline Alcy Jabouin2m 56s
Holly Garcia11s
John Hanlon52s
Katy Rogers1m 3s
Michael Marchese1m 28s
Peter Pietrantonio1m 57s
Robert Van Campen1m 45s
Stephanie Martins1m 51s
Stephanie Smith3m 51s
Town Clerk4m 14s
Wayne Matewsky4m 11s

Speaker × Topic Heatmap

Brighter cells indicate more time. Hover for exact values.

SpeakerBudget & TaxesEconomic DevelopmentEducationEnvironmentHousingInfrastructurePublic SafetySocial ServicesTransportation
Guerline Alcy Jabouin0s2m 6s0s0s0s50s0s0s0s
Holly Garcia0s0s0s11s0s0s0s0s0s
John Hanlon5s0s0s0s0s0s0s47s0s
Katy Rogers0s0s0s0s0s1m 3s0s0s0s
Michael Marchese0s0s0s1m 28s0s0s0s0s0s
Peter Pietrantonio0s0s0s50s0s17s29s21s0s
Robert Van Campen24s0s0s0s0s58s0s0s23s
Stephanie Martins0s0s0s0s0s14s0s1m 37s0s
Stephanie Smith14s0s0s0s1m 5s1m 42s0s0s50s
Town Clerk56s0s21s32s0s1m 9s32s0s44s
Wayne Matewsky0s0s0s0s0s0s0s4m 11s0s